About the Role:
We are seeking a highly organised and proactive LPN Lead to support the onboarding, training, and performance management of new and current MAs. This role is ideal for an experienced MA who thrives in a fast-paced, team-oriented environment and is passionate about elevating the quality and consistency of patient care through operational excellence.
Key Responsibilities
Training & Onboarding
Onboard and train new Medical Assistants, ensuring smooth integration into the Flagler workflow.
Manage new hires through their initial 4-week training phase, monitoring readiness for team placement.
Schedule additional training sessions when issues or knowledge gaps are identified.
Performance Oversight
Conduct daily and ad hoc quality checks.
Monitor key performance indicators including:
Number of patient interactions
Fallout and retention rates
Protocol adherence
Accuracy of documentation and patient statuses
Schedule buddy shifts and peer support based on performance data and training needs.
Issue Management
Address issues flagged by team leaders, such as time management or training gaps.
Identify and report structural issues or repeated errors to leadership (Leon/Dasha).
Provide constructive feedback and assign action items to MAs based on performance reviews.
MA Engagement & Development
Conduct monthly check-ins with all MAs, including former team leads.
Document feedback, complete performance review templates, and set monthly goals and assignments.
Team Collaboration
Lead the “housekeeping” section of weekly MA team syncs, sharing examples, screenshots, and reminders.
Assist in assigning patients to MAs after upload to the platform.
Support schedule management, including coverage coordination and team adjustments.
Qualifications
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N)
3+ years of previous experience training or supervising MAs required
Strong organizational, time management, and communication skills
Detail-oriented with a passion for process improvement
Comfortable using dashboards and documentation tools to track performance
Team player who thrives in a dynamic, collaborative environment
Compensation: $26-28/hour; negotiable based on experience

What you need to know about the NYC Tech Scene
Key Facts About NYC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 549,200; 6%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Capgemini, Bloomberg, IBM, Spotify
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, Fintech
- Funding Landscape: $25.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Greycroft, Thrive Capital, Union Square Ventures, FirstMark Capital, Tiger Global Management, Tribeca Venture Partners, Insight Partners, Two Sigma Ventures
- Research Centers and Universities: Columbia University, New York University, Fordham University, CUNY, AI Now Institute, Flatiron Institute, C.N. Yang Institute for Theoretical Physics, NASA Space Radiation Laboratory
